Join The Fabric User Research Panel!

As you probably know, I work on the Fabric Customer Advisory Team at Microsoft. Apart from advising customers a lot of our team’s time is spent collecting feedback about Fabric and sending it back to the relevant people in the Fabric product group so they can fix the problems that need fixing and build the features that need building. We have always worked with different communities of customers to collect this feedback but now we’re launching a much larger-scale programme: the Fabric User Research Panel. If you’re the type of person who reads my blog then you’re the type of person we want to recruit for it.

When you join the Fabric User Research Panel you will be able to:

  • Meet with Fabric product managers, designers, researchers, and engineering teams
  • Share your real-world experiences to help improve Fabric

Joining the panel is free, and you can choose to leave the panel at any time.
